Transaction 0063423eb83638069973d487331a5cf5c2baa056107b8f295a4d38a078d37bec
1 Input
1 Output
-
0063423eb83638069973d487331a5cf5c2baa056107b8f295a4d38a078d37bec:0
- value
- 1142952688
- script pubkey
- OP_0 OP_PUSHBYTES_20 c522998f4ffbb1da41aadf13f6c8b7b7cb948478
- address
- ltc1qc53fnr60lwca5sd2mufldj9hkl9efprce8c57e